Transaction 60b906f9ca2db62ce53af279bfb806f10e80f0f1500e417421206842f6635a0e
1 Input
1 Output
-
60b906f9ca2db62ce53af279bfb806f10e80f0f1500e417421206842f6635a0e:0
- value
- 306418536
- script pubkey
- OP_0 OP_PUSHBYTES_20 b61a26f97c5c3922d9d96fcb4c6a52d2b68d27b3
- address
- bc1qkcdzd7tutsuj9kwedl95c6jj62mg6fan8930dk